MINDS OF ASPIRANTS Anthropology Concept Series Episode 17 Non-Human Primate Social Groups “Social organization is an evolutionary adaptation that enhances survival, reproduction, and cooperation among primates.” ⸻ 1. Solitary (Dispersed) Social System 🐒 Adults live alone except during mating. Examples: Orangutan Some nocturnal prosimians (Lorises) Features Large home ranges Minimal social interaction Male territories overlap with females Reduces competition for food ⸻ 2. One Male – One Female Group (Monogamy) 👨‍👩‍👦 One adult male and one adult female with offspring. Examples Gibbons Siamangs Features Pair bonding Shared parental care Territorial defence by both sexes Low sexual dimorphism Adaptive Significance Stable care for offspring and efficient territory defence. ⸻ 3. One Female – Several Males (Polyandry) 👩 One reproductive female with multiple males. Examples Tamarins Marmosets Features Cooperative infant care Males carry infants High paternal investment Rare among primates Evolutionary Benefit Increases offspring survival. ⸻ 4. One Male – Several Female Group (Polygyny / Harem System) 👨 One dominant male with multiple females and young. Examples Gorillas Hanuman Langurs Gelada Baboons Features Strong sexual dimorphism Male protects the group Intense male competition Infanticide may occur after male takeover Sexual selection and reproductive success. ⸻ 5. Multi-Male – Multi-Female Group 👨👩 Multiple adult males and females live together. Examples Chimpanzees Baboons Rhesus Macaques Features Dominance hierarchy Alliances and coalitions Complex communication Grooming strengthens social bonds ⸻ 6. Fission–Fusion Society 🔄 Group size changes according to food availability and social needs. Examples Chimpanzees Spider Monkeys Features Large community divided into temporary subgroups Flexible membership Reduces feeding competition High cognitive ability required

MINDS OF ANTHROPOLOGY – CONCEPT SERIES Episode 16: Leela Dube’s Study of Islam and Matriliny in Lakshadweep Thinker Leela Dube (1923–2012) One of India’s foremost feminist anthropologists, Leela Dube integrated kinship, gender, religion, and property relations into anthropological analysis. She challenged the assumption that patriarchy is universal and highlighted the importance of local cultural contexts. ⸻ The Study Title Conflict and Compromise: Devolution and Disposal of Property in a Matrilineal Muslim Society (1994) Study Area Kalpeni Island, Lakshadweep Muslim community practising matrilineal descent ⸻ Research Question How can an Islamic society, generally regarded as patriarchal, coexist with a matrilineal system of descent and property inheritance? ⸻ Research Methodology Leela Dube employed a qualitative ethnographic approach consisting of: Participant Observation Long-term Fieldwork Genealogical Method Case Studies of Families Interviews with Men and Women Analysis of Kinship and Inheritance Patterns Study of Property Transactions and Legal Practices Methodological Perspective Feminist Anthropology Kinship Studies Comparative Ethnography ⸻ Major Findings 1. Islam and Matriliny Coexist Islamic belief and matrilineal descent are not mutually exclusive. ⸻ 2. Descent through Women Membership in the lineage passes through the mother’s line, unlike most Muslim societies. ⸻ 3. Women Enjoy Greater Economic Security Women possess stronger claims over ancestral property, giving them greater social and economic stability. ⸻ 4. Residence Pattern Although influenced by Islam, family life retained important matrilocal/Duolocal strengthening women’s position. ⸻ 5. Property Rights are Negotiated Inheritance follows neither “pure Islamic law” nor “pure matriliny.” Instead, people develop practical compromises based on local customs. ⸻ 6. Local Culture Shapes Religion Religious doctrines are adapted to fit existing cultural institutions rather than replacing them entirely. ⸻ 7. Patriarchy is Context-Specific Islam does not produce identical gender relations everywhere. Local ecology, economy and kinship modify its expression. ⸻ 8. Kinship Influences Gender Women’s status depends not only on religion but also on descent, inheritance and residence patterns. ⸻ 9. Tradition is Dynamic Kinship institutions continuously negotiate between customary law and religious law. ⸻ 10. Importance for Anthropology The study demonstrates that institutions are culturally flexible, challenging universal assumptions about patriarchy and religion. ⸻ Significance Leela Dube showed that religion cannot be understood in isolation from kinship and culture. Her work demonstrates that local societies creatively adapt universal religious principles to their own social structures. This became a landmark contribution to feminist anthropology, kinship studies, and the anthropology of religion.

MINDS OF ASPIRANTS – ANTHROPOLOGY CONCEPT SERIES Episode 15 Clifford Geertz’s View on Religion UPSC Anthropology PYQ “Discuss Clifford Geertz’s view on religion.” (Paper I – Religion & Symbolic Anthropology) ⸻ Clifford Geertz,Interpretive (Symbolic) Anthropology, viewed religion not merely as belief in supernatural beings but as a cultural system of symbols that gives meaning to human existence. For Geertz, religion helps people interpret reality, cope with uncertainty, and make life meaningful. ⸻ Geertz’s Definition of Religion “Religion is a system of symbols which acts to establish powerful, pervasive and long-lasting moods and motivations in men by formulating conceptions of a general order of existence and clothing these conceptions with such an aura of factuality that the moods and motivations seem uniquely realistic.” ⸻ Breaking Down Geertz’s Definition 1. Religion is a System of Symbols Religion communicates through symbols that represent deeper meanings. Examples Om – Hinduism Cross – Christianity Crescent – Islam Bodhi Tree – Buddhism These symbols are not merely objects; they embody sacred ideas and values. ⸻ 2. Symbols Create Powerful and Lasting Moods Religious symbols shape: Emotions Morality Behaviour Social values Thus, religion influences how people think and act throughout life. ⸻ 3. Religion Explains the General Order of Existence Religion answers fundamental questions: Why are we born? Why do people suffer? Why do people die? What happens after death? It provides a worldview (cosmology) that makes the universe intelligible. ⸻ 4. Religion Gives These Ideas an Aura of Reality Believers do not see religious ideas as myths. They perceive them as ultimate truths, making religious values appear factual and unquestionable. ⸻ 5. Religion Makes Human Behaviour Meaningful Because religious beliefs are accepted as real, people willingly follow religious ethics, rituals and moral principles. Religion therefore becomes a guide for everyday life. ⸻ How Does Religion Sort Chaos? According to Geertz, humans constantly encounter situations that create chaos and threaten the meaning of life. Religion restores order by providing symbolic explanations. He identifies three major forms of chaos: 1. Bafflement (Cognitive Chaos) People face events they cannot explain. Example: Natural disasters, miracles, strange phenomena. Religion provides explanations through myths, beliefs and sacred narratives, making the unknown understandable. ⸻ 2. Suffering (Emotional Chaos) Illness, death, loss and pain challenge human endurance. Religion gives suffering a purpose by presenting it as: A test of faith Divine will Karma A path to salvation Thus, suffering becomes meaningful rather than meaningless. ⸻ 3. Ethical Paradox (Moral Chaos) People often wonder: Why do good people suffer? Why do evil people prosper? Why is justice delayed? Religion answers these paradoxes through ideas such as: Divine justice Karma Heaven and Hell Ultimate moral order This restores faith in justice and morality. ⸻ Religion as a Cultural System Symbols ⬇ Create Meaning ⬇ Develop Worldview ⬇ Reduce Chaos ⬇ Guide Human Behaviour

MINDS OF ASPIRANTS – Anthropology Concept Series Episode 14 “Man is a Primate.” – Justify (UPSC Anthropology PYQ) Introduction Primates are an order of mammals (Order: Primates) characterized by evolutionary adaptations for arboreal life, enhanced vision, manual dexterity, and advanced brain development. Humans possess all the fundamental diagnostic features of primates, though many have been modified due to bipedalism and cultural evolution. Hence, man is scientifically classified as a primate. ⸻ Characteristics of Primates (with Human Relevance) 1. Pentadactyl Limbs Five digits on each hand and foot. Primitive mammalian characteristic retained by all primates (except minor modifications in some species). Humans: Five fingers and five toes. ⸻ 2. Prehensile (Grasping) Hands Highly developed hands capable of grasping and manipulating objects. Increased manual dexterity. Human significance Precision movements Tool making Writing and fine motor skills ⸻ 3. Opposable Thumb Thumb can oppose other fingers. Enables: Power grip Precision grip Human adaptation Greatest degree of thumb opposition among primates. Basis for technology and craftsmanship. ⸻ 4. Flat Nails (Not Claws) Nails replace claws. Protect fingertips without reducing tactile sensitivity. Finger pads possess dermatoglyphics (fingerprints). Human significance Better tactile sensation. Fine object manipulation. ⸻ 5. Generalized Limb Structure Retention of clavicle. Separate radius & ulna; tibia & fibula. Highly mobile shoulder joint. Human modification Upper limb specialized for manipulation rather than locomotion. ⸻ 6. Erect Posture Trend toward upright posture. Most primates can sit erect. Humans show habitual bipedalism, the highest expression of this feature. ⸻ 7. Forward-Facing Eyes Eyes placed in front of the face. Overlapping visual fields. Result: Binocular vision Stereoscopic (3D) vision Accurate depth perception Essential for: Arboreal locomotion Hand-eye coordination ⸻ 8. Reduced Sense of Smell Olfactory organs relatively reduced. Snout shortened. Vision becomes dominant. Humans rely primarily on: Vision Hearing Intelligence ⸻ 9. Enlarged Brain High encephalization quotient. Expanded cerebral cortex. Better memory, learning and planning. Humans possess the largest and most complex brain among living primates. ⸻ 10. Heterodont Dentition Dental formula: 2.1.2.3 / 2.1.2.3 = 32 teeth Different teeth perform different functions: Incisors – Cutting Canines – Tearing Premolars – Crushing Molars – Grinding ⸻ 11. One Pair of Mammary Glands Thoracic (chest) position. Nourishment and prolonged parental care. ⸻ 12. Reduced Litter Size Usually one offspring. Greater parental investment. Increased survival. Humans show the greatest parental care among primates. ⸻ 13. Long Gestation & Juvenile Period Slow growth. Delayed maturity. Extended learning period. Humans exhibit: Longest childhood Long socialization Cultural transmission ⸻ 14. Long Life Span Primates generally live longer than mammals of similar body size. Humans possess one of the longest life spans. ⸻ 15. Complex Social Behaviour Group living Cooperation Grooming Communication Dominance hierarchies Humans further developed: Language Culture Institutions Religion Economy Politics

MINDS OF ASPIRANTS – CONCEPT SERIES Episode 13: Social and Cultural Anthropology – Understanding Human Society and Culture “Social and Cultural Anthropology is the branch of anthropology that studies human societies, cultures, institutions, beliefs, values, and patterns of social behaviour across time and space.” It seeks to answer fundamental questions about how humans organise their societies, create cultures, maintain social relationships, and adapt to changing environments. Through intensive fieldwork and participant observation, social anthropologists understand societies from the perspective of the people themselves. By integrating evidence from ethnography, kinship studies, religion, economics, politics, and symbolism, Social and Cultural Anthropology explains both the diversity and the commonality of human life. ⸻ Key Components of Social and Cultural Anthropology 1. Kinship and Family Studies systems of descent, marriage, family organisation, inheritance, and social relationships. Explains how kinship forms the foundation of social organisation in different societies. ⸻ 2. Economic Anthropology Examines production, exchange, reciprocity, redistribution, and consumption in human societies. Demonstrates that economies are embedded within social and cultural relationships rather than governed solely by markets. ⸻ 3. Political Anthropology Studies leadership, authority, power, law, conflict resolution, and political organisation. Explains how societies maintain order through both formal institutions and customary practices. ⸻ 4. Religion and Symbolism Explores religious beliefs, rituals, myths, magic, symbolism, and worldviews. Examines how religion provides meaning, social cohesion, and cultural identity. ⸻ 5. Social Stratification and Social Change Studies caste, class, ethnicity, gender, inequality, urbanisation, migration, globalisation, and social transformation. Analyses how societies evolve while preserving cultural continuity. ⸻ 6. Research Methods (Ethnography) Uses participant observation, fieldwork, interviews, genealogies, and case studies to understand cultures from an insider’s perspective. Ethnography remains the hallmark of Social and Cultural Anthropology. ⸻ Why is Social and Cultural Anthropology Important? Explains the diversity of human societies and cultures. Promotes cultural relativism and reduces ethnocentrism. Helps understand institutions such as family, religion, economy, and politics. Contributes to public policy, tribal welfare, development, healthcare, education, and conflict resolution. Bridges anthropology with sociology, history, political science, economics, and psychology. Provides insights into contemporary issues such as globalisation, migration, digital culture, identity, and social change. ⸻ Important Anthropologists Edward B. Tylor – Father of Cultural Anthropology; Classical definition of culture Lewis Henry Morgan – Evolution of kinship and social organisation Franz Boas – Historical Particularism; Cultural Relativism Bronislaw Malinowski – Functionalism; Participant Observation A.R. Radcliffe-Brown – Structural Functionalism Claude Lévi-Strauss – Structuralism Margaret Mead – Culture and Personality Clifford Geertz – Interpretive Anthropology; Thick Description ⸻ Important Indian Anthropologists M. N. Srinivas – Sanskritization, Westernization, Dominant Caste Nirmal Kumar Bose – Hindu Society and Tribal Studies S. C. Dube – Indian Village Studies Irawati Karve – Kinship Organisation in India L. P. Vidyarthi – Sacred Complex D. N. Majumdar – Tribe and Rural Society Studies Surajit Sinha – State Formation and Tribal Studies

MINDS OF ASPIRANTS – CONCEPT SERIES Episode 11: Biological Anthropology – Understanding Humans as Biological Beings “Biological Anthropology is the scientific study of human evolution, biological variation, and adaptation across time and space.” It seeks to answer one of humanity’s oldest questions—Who are we, where did we come from, and how did we become what we are today? By integrating evidence from fossils, genetics, comparative anatomy, primate behaviour, and living human populations, biological anthropology reconstructs the evolutionary story of humankind. Key Components of Biological Anthropology 1. Human Palaeontology (Palaeoanthropology) Studies fossil evidence of human ancestors. Reconstructs the evolutionary history of hominins. Explains major adaptations such as bipedalism, increased brain size, and tool use. 2. Primatology Studies the behaviour, anatomy, and ecology of non-human primates. Helps understand human social behaviour, intelligence, communication, and evolution through comparison with chimpanzees, gorillas, orangutans, and monkeys. 3. Human Variation Examines biological differences among present-day human populations. Explains variations in skin colour, body proportions, blood groups, disease resistance, and physiological adaptations. Demonstrates that human diversity is an outcome of evolutionary adaptation, not biological superiority. 4. Human Genetics Studies inheritance, DNA, mutation, gene flow, and population history. Reconstructs migration routes and evolutionary relationships among human populations. 5. Human Adaptation Investigates how humans adapt biologically to different environments such as high altitudes, deserts, Arctic regions, and tropical climates. Connects environmental pressures with evolutionary change. Why is Biological Anthropology Important? Explains the origin and evolution of Homo sapiens. Provides evidence for Darwinian evolution. Helps understand human diversity through scientific methods. Contributes to medicine, forensic science, archaeology, and conservation biology. Bridges biology with anthropology to explain the interaction between genes, environment, and culture. Important Anthropologists Charles Darwin – Theory of Evolution by Natural Selection Thomas Henry Huxley – Comparative anatomy and human evolution Sherwood Washburn – New Physical (Biological) Anthropology Raymond Dart – Discovery of Australopithecus africanus Louis Leakey – East African fossil discoveries Mary Leakey – Laetoli footprints and hominin fossils Richard Leakey – Early Homo fossils in Kenya Jane Goodall – Chimpanzee behaviour

MINDS OF ASPIRANTS Concept Series – Episode 10 SOCIOBIOLOGY Definition Sociobiology is the study of the biological and evolutionary basis of social behaviour. It explains how natural selection shapes behaviours that improve an individual’s reproductive success (fitness) and ensure the survival of its genes. ⸻ Core Principle The central idea of sociobiology is: Behaviour evolves because it increases the chances of passing genes to the next generation. In other words, Natural Selection → Behaviour → Survival → Reproduction → Gene Continuity ⸻ Key Concepts 1. Genotype vs Phenotype Genotype: Genetic makeup. Phenotype: Observable characteristics, including behaviour. Sociobiology argues that behaviour (phenotype) has evolved to protect and propagate genes (genotype). ⸻ 2. Behaviour has Evolutionary Value Every social behaviour should make evolutionary sense. Examples: Cooperation Parental care Group living Warning calls Food sharing These behaviours survive because they increase reproductive success. ⸻ 3. Kin Selection The most important concept in sociobiology. Individuals help their genetic relatives because relatives share many of the same genes. Helping relatives indirectly helps your own genes survive. Examples Mother caring for children. Worker bees protecting the queen. Squirrels giving alarm calls to relatives. ⸻ 4. Inclusive Fitness Fitness is not only about your own offspring. It also includes the reproductive success of your close relatives. Inclusive Fitness = Personal Reproductive Success + Success of Genetic Relatives ⸻ 5. Altruism Helping another individual at a cost to yourself. Example: A monkey warning others about a predator. At first glance it seems disadvantageous, but if the beneficiaries are relatives, the helper’s genes are still being promoted. ⸻ 6. Reciprocal Altruism Helping non-relatives with the expectation that they will help you in the future. Example: Vampire bats sharing blood meals. Primates grooming each other. Sentinel behaviour among unrelated animals. Principle: “I help you today; you help me tomorrow.” ⸻ 7. Fitness Fitness means reproductive success. The individual leaving the highest number of surviving offspring has the greatest evolutionary fitness. Criticism of Sociobiology Overemphasizes genes while underestimating culture. Human behaviour is also shaped by learning, environment, and social institutions. Sometimes misused to justify racism or social inequality (not supported by modern biology).

MINDS OF ASPIRANTS Concept Series | Episode 9 Anthropology Mains’26 Clifford Geertz: Meaning of Symbol 1. Culture is a System of Symbols For Geertz, culture is a network (complex) of symbols through which people understand and interpret reality. 2. Religion is a Symbolic Subsystem Religion is not the only system of symbols; it is a sacred symbolic component within the larger cultural system. 3. Symbol as a Vehicle of Meaning A symbol is any object, act, event, quality, or relationship that represents an idea. It acts as a vehicle for conveying concepts. 4. Symbols are Tangible Expressions of Ideas Symbols transform abstract thoughts into concrete forms. Example: The Cross, Om (ॐ), National Flag. 5. Symbols are Multi-layered A single symbol can possess multiple meanings depending on the cultural context and interpretation. 6. Symbolic vs Empirical Reality Geertz distinguishes between: Empirical reality → Actual social action. Symbolic reality → The meaning or blueprint behind the action. Illustration: Building a house (empirical) vs. House plan (symbolic). 7. Culture is an Extrinsic Source of Information Human behaviour is guided by culture, not merely by instinct. Culture exists outside the individual and provides behavioural guidance. 8. Culture is Learned, Not Biological Culture has no genetic basis. It is acquired through socialisation and enculturation. 9. Symbols Ensure Cultural Continuity Cultural knowledge is stored and transmitted through shared symbols from one generation to another. 10. Culture is Both a Model of and Model for Behaviour Model of reality → Explains how society is. Model for reality → Prescribes how individuals ought to behave. Since culture is symbolic, it is also modifiable and dynamic. ⸻ Keywords to use: Symbolic Anthropology Interpretive Anthropology Web of Significance Vehicle of Meaning Sacred Symbols Model of Reality Model for Reality Cultural Transmission Symbolic Communication Enculturation “Man is an animal suspended in webs of significance he himself has spun.” — Clifford Geertz

MINDS OF ASPIRANTS | CONCEPT SERIES Episode 8 – Clifford Geertz’s Interpretative Theory (20 Ready-to-Write Points) 1. Proponent Interpretative Theory was proposed by Clifford Geertz (1973). 2. Definition of Culture Culture is a system of shared meanings, not merely customs, institutions or behaviour. 3. Interconnected Meanings Every cultural element derives its meaning from its relationship with other cultural elements. 4. Holistic Nature No cultural practice can be understood in isolation; it must be interpreted as part of the entire cultural system. 5. Webs of Significance Humans are “suspended in webs of significance” that they themselves have created. 6. Culture as a Symbolic System Culture consists of symbols that communicate meanings shared by members of society. 7. Role of Enculturation Individuals acquire cultural meanings through enculturation, learning the symbolic world of their society. 8. Everyday Behaviour is Symbolic Daily actions, rituals and practices express deeper symbolic meanings. 9. Sacredness is Culturally Constructed Sacred beings, sacred places and sacred objects derive their significance from the wider cultural system. 10. Example of Colours Colours become auspicious or inauspicious because of the meanings assigned to them by a culture. 11. Context is Essential Every cultural act becomes meaningful only when interpreted within its cultural context. 12. Anthropology as Interpretation Anthropology is “not an experimental science in search of laws, but an interpretative one in search of meanings.” 13. Rejection of Positivism Geertz criticised positivism for attempting to discover universal laws of human behaviour. 14. Concept of Thick Description Anthropologists should provide “thick description” by uncovering the deeper meanings behind actions. 15. Beyond Surface Observation Thick description goes beyond describing behaviour to explain why the behaviour is meaningful. 16. Actor’s Perspective Interpretation should capture the meaning intended by the actor, not merely the observer’s explanation. 17. Questions an Anthropologist Should Ask What does the act mean? Why was it performed? How does it relate to the wider cultural system? 18. Culture Consists of Public Meanings Cultural meanings are public because they are shared and understood collectively by members of society. 19. Role of the Anthropologist The anthropologist should understand the “informal logic of everyday life” through close engagement with people. 20. Ethnographic Writing Ethnography should remain close to lived experiences, avoid excessive abstraction and accept that culture is often dynamic, fluid and fuzzy rather than rigid. ⸻ Keywords for UPSC Answers System of meanings Webs of significance Symbols Enculturation Cultural context Thick description Public meanings Interpretative anthropology Actor’s perspective Informal logic of everyday life Symbolic interpretation Critique of positivism Minds of Aspirants| Mains’26

MINDS OF ASPIRANTS – CONCEPT SERIES Episode 7: The Controversy Surrounding Ramapithecus and Sivapithecus For nearly four decades, Ramapithecus occupied a central position in the debate on human evolution. Initially regarded as one of the earliest human ancestors, later discoveries and improved fossil evidence dramatically altered this interpretation. The controversy surrounding Ramapithecus and Sivapithecus is one of the most important examples of how scientific knowledge evolves with new evidence. ⸻ Why did the controversy arise? The controversy emerged because: Fossil evidence was extremely fragmentary, consisting mainly of teeth and jaw fragments. Different researchers interpreted the same fossils differently. New fossil discoveries from different regions were given different names. Improved comparative studies later suggested that many of these fossils belonged to the same evolutionary group. ⸻ Historical Development 1. Discovery (1934) G. Edward Lewis discovered jaw fragments in the Siwalik Hills. He named the fossil Ramapithecus, believing it represented a new primate. ⸻ 2. Multiple Fossil Names As more fossils were discovered from Europe, Africa and Asia, researchers classified them under different genera based on locality: Ramapithecus Sivapithecus Kenyapithecus Graecopithecus Rudapithecus This created taxonomic confusion. ⸻ 3. Simon and Pilbeam’s Revision (1965) After examining all available fossils, Simons and Pilbeam concluded that most specimens actually belonged to only two major groups: A. Sivapithecus More ape-like characteristics. Considered an ancestor of great apes. B. Rudapithecus Showed relatively more hominid-like dental features. Considered a possible early hominid. This reduced the number of separate genera but did not completely resolve the controversy. ⸻ The Main Controversy In 1968, Simons summarized two competing hypotheses. View 1: Ramapithecus was an ape According to this view: Ramapithecus was simply a small-faced ape. Its resemblance to humans was only superficial. Human-like teeth evolved independently. Thus, Ramapithecus was not a direct human ancestor. ⸻ View 2: Evidence was insufficient Another school argued: Only teeth and jaw fragments were available. No skull or limb bones existed. Therefore, it was impossible to confidently classify Ramapithecus. Some scientists even called it a “dental hominid”, because only the teeth appeared human-like. ⸻ Why was Ramapithecus initially considered a human ancestor? Pilbeam (1972) argued that Ramapithecus possessed several hominid-like features: Dental Features Thick enamel Smaller canine teeth Reduced diastema Human-like molars Facial Features Shorter face Less projecting snout These similarities led many anthropologists to believe that Ramapithecus lay on the evolutionary line leading to: Ramapithecus → Australopithecus → Homo ⸻ The Sivapithecus Hypothesis Further fossil discoveries changed the picture. Scientists found much more complete fossils of Sivapithecus, including facial bones. These revealed: Orangutan-like facial anatomy Ape-like skull structure Arboreal adaptations Consequently, Ramapithecus was reinterpreted as the female or smaller form of Sivapithecus rather than an early human ancestor. Today, most anthropologists regard Ramapithecus as belonging to the genus Sivapithecus rather than a separate hominid genus. ⸻ Present Scientific Consensus Modern evidence—including detailed anatomical comparisons and molecular studies—supports that: Ramapithecus is not an early hominid. It is now treated as part of Sivapithecus. Sivapithecus is considered closely related to the lineage leading to the modern orangutan (Pongo). Therefore, Ramapithecus no longer occupies a place in the direct ancestry of humans. Conclusion The Ramapithecus–Sivapithecus controversy illustrates how paleoanthropology is a dynamic science, where new fossil discoveries transformed Ramapithecus from a presumed human ancestor into a member of the ape lineage closely related to Sivapithecus and the modern orangutan.

MoA Concept Series Episode 6: The Loneliness of the Narmada Human – India’s Missing Chapter in Human Evolution When we think of human evolution, names like Lucy (Ethiopia), Java Man (Indonesia), Peking Man (China) or the Neanderthals (Europe) immediately come to mind. Yet, hidden in the heart of India lies one of the most fascinating mysteries of paleoanthropology—the Narmada Human. Discovered in 1982 by geologist Arun Sonakia from the Hathnora site in the Narmada Valley (Madhya Pradesh), the fossilized skull cap of the Narmada Human remains the only well-preserved hominin fossil ever discovered in the Indian subcontinent. Even after more than four decades, it continues to stand alone—earning the title “The Loneliness of the Narmada Human.” Why is the Narmada Human so important? India lies geographically between Africa, where modern humans originated, and East Asia, where several archaic human species evolved. Logically, India should contain abundant evidence of human migration and evolution. Surprisingly, the fossil record is almost empty. This makes the Narmada fossil extraordinarily valuable. It is a crucial missing piece in understanding how ancient humans dispersed across Asia. Who exactly was the Narmada Human? This is where the mystery begins. Scientists have proposed multiple identities: • Some classify it as Homo erectus, the species that first spread out of Africa. • Others argue that it represents archaic Homo sapiens because of its combination of primitive and modern features. • A few researchers even believe it resembles Homo heidelbergensis, the common ancestor of Neanderthals and modern humans. Since no complete skeleton has been found, there is still no scientific consensus regarding its exact classification. Why are fossils so rare in India? Several factors work against fossil preservation: India’s tropical climate accelerates decomposition. Heavy monsoon rainfall causes erosion. Geological disturbances destroy fossil-bearing layers. Compared to Africa and Europe, systematic paleoanthropological excavations have been limited. As a result, India possesses thousands of Stone Age tools but remarkably few human fossils. What does the Narmada Human tell us? The discovery highlights that India was not merely a passage between Africa and East Asia but may have been an important centre in human evolution itself. The Narmada Valley has yielded: Acheulean stone tools Rich fossil fauna Evidence of repeated prehistoric human occupation Together, these indicate that central India supported hominin populations for hundreds of thousands of years.
